Defining a promoted property

When you create a message flow, you can promote properties from individual nodes in that message flow to the message flow level. Properties promoted in this way override the property values that you have set for the individual nodes.

Some of the properties that you can promote to the message flow are also configurable; you can modify them when you deploy the broker archive file in which you have stored the message flow to each broker. If you set values for configurable properties when you deploy a broker archive file, the values that you set override values set in the individual nodes, and those that you have promoted.
